AI, Data, and the Future of Mathematical Thinking

from Adding It All Up

Latrenda and Dewey welcome Ken Ono to the podcast to discuss the evolving role of mathematics during Mathematics and Statistics Awareness Month. Discover how data, artificial intelligence, and real-world applications—from classroom investigations to Olympic swimming performance—are reshaping how we think about math education.More:Mathematics and Statistics Awareness MonthKen Ono on XKen Ono - Open Scholar
